Use a deposit that reflects risk without becoming a hidden penalty. Apply the rule consistently, record exceptions and verify the current consumer-law treatment for your contract and service.",[15,23,24],{},"The purpose is not to punish clients. It is to make scarce appointment time and mutual expectations visible. A rule that staff cannot explain or the system cannot execute will create more disputes than it prevents.",[26,27,29],"h2",{"id":28},"what-should-a-salon-cancellation-policy-include","What should a salon cancellation policy include?",[15,31,32],{},"Write in plain language and cover:",[34,35,36,40,43,46,49,52,55,58],"ul",{},[37,38,39],"li",{},"how much notice counts as an ordinary cancellation;",[37,41,42],{},"how the client cancels or reschedules;",[37,44,45],{},"what happens after the deadline;",[37,47,48],{},"how a no-show differs from a late cancellation, if it does;",[37,50,51],{},"whether a deposit is refunded, retained or moved;",[37,53,54],{},"what happens when the salon cancels;",[37,56,57],{},"exceptions for illness, emergency or service-specific safety;",[37,59,60],{},"who may approve an exception and how the client complains.",[15,62,63],{},"Show the essential rule before booking confirmation and link the full terms. Have your actual terms reviewed when stakes or edge cases are significant.",[26,76,78],{"id":77},"how-long-should-the-cancellation-window-be","How long should the cancellation window be?",[15,80,81],{},"Match it to the chance of reselling the time, the preparation required and the value of the blocked resources. A short haircut and a multi-hour procedure using a specialist room create different exposure. One universal window may be easy to remember but unfair or ineffective across every service.",[15,83,84],{},"Use evidence from your calendar. Measure when cancelled slots are usually refilled and how lead time differs by service, weekday and specialist. Start with a simple rule and avoid a maze of exceptions clients cannot predict.",[15,86,87,88,92],{},"The deadline must be operationally possible. If the only cancellation channel is a phone line that closes before the deadline, clients need another reliable method. The ",[68,89,91],{"href":90},"\u002Fhelp\u002Fen\u002Fonline-booking\u002Fyour-booking-page\u002F","public booking-page guide"," explains the client journey; test cancellation and rescheduling on mobile as carefully as initial booking.",[26,94,96],{"id":95},"how-should-a-deposit-be-calculated","How should a deposit be calculated?",[15,98,99],{},"A deposit can be a fixed amount or a percentage. Model at least three values:",[34,101,102,105,108],{},[37,103,104],{},"payment-provider cost and refund handling;",[37,106,107],{},"direct preparation or material committed before arrival;",[37,109,110],{},"realistic loss when a late slot cannot be resold.",[15,112,113],{},"Avoid assuming the deposit must equal the full service price. A lower percentage may create adequate commitment with less friction. A high-risk, long procedure may justify a different rule from a brief repeat visit. State whether the remainder is paid at the visit and how a redeemed package or gift card interacts with prepayment.",[15,115,116,117,121],{},"Tervita's ",[68,118,120],{"href":119},"\u002Fhelp\u002Fen\u002Fonline-booking\u002Fonline-prepayment\u002F","online-prepayment guide"," describes the actual product workflow: connect Stripe or Montonio, set an organisation default percentage, override it per service, and reconcile the amount already paid at point of sale. Pending reminders must follow the new time, and cancelled visits must stop unsent messages. The ",[68,201,203],{"href":202},"\u002Fblog\u002Fen\u002Fsalon-sms-appointment-reminders\u002F","SMS-reminder guide"," shows why state consistency matters.",[15,206,207],{},"At point of sale, show the prepayment separately so staff collect only the remainder. Prevent the same amount being applied twice. Refunds need an owner, reason and traceable result in both the payment provider and salon records.",[26,209,211],{"id":210},"how-should-exceptions-be-handled-fairly","How should exceptions be handled fairly?",[15,213,214],{},"Consistency does not mean refusing judgement. Define a small set of exception categories and who can approve them. Record the category rather than sensitive detail: for example, “safety exception approved” may be enough without copying a diagnosis into general notes.",[15,216,217],{},"Review exception frequency. If half of late cancellations require an override, the rule, notice, booking horizon or cancellation channel may be wrong. If exceptions cluster under one employee, training or authority may be unclear.",[15,219,220,221,225],{},"Never require a client to attend when symptoms, contraindications or safety concerns make the service inappropriate merely to avoid losing a deposit.
